How Rossford Police Department's Approach to Community Policing Actually Works

At its core, the Rossford Police Department's Approach to Community Policing is built on the principle that police effectiveness is deeply intertwined with public trust and cooperation. Instead of operating solely from a patrol car, this model encourages officers to spend dedicated time out of their vehicles, engaging directly with residents and business owners. This can take many forms, such as participating in local events, holding informal meet-and-greets, or walking through neighborhoods to listen to concerns. The goal is to transition from being solely seen as a reactive emergency force to being a visible, approachable resource for the entire community.

Practically, this approach involves structured initiatives designed to break down barriers. For example, an officer might host a monthly coffee hour at a local library or community center, creating a safe space for open dialogue about neighborhood issues. Problem-solving becomes a shared effort, where police work collaboratively with citizens to identify issues like street lighting or noise disturbances and develop strategies together. By focusing on relationship-building and consistent presence, the Rossford Police Department's Approach to Community Policing aims to create a feedback loop where intelligence flows more freely and public perceptions of safety can shift positively over time.

Common Questions People Have About Rossford Police Department's Approach to Community Policing

Many people wonder how exactly this community-focused model impacts day-to-day policing and emergency response times. A common question is whether this emphasis on dialogue and relationship-building diverts resources from traditional patrols and emergency services. In reality, the Rossford Police Department's Approach to Community Policing is typically integrated as a core function rather than a separate entity, meaning officers are still available for urgent calls while also dedicating specific time to community engagement. The underlying theory is that strong community ties can actually make emergency responses more efficient by fostering public cooperation and information sharing.

Another frequent inquiry revolves around measuring the success of such programs. Unlike simple metrics like arrest numbers, the Ross福德 Police Department's Approach to Community Policing often looks at softer indicators, such as increased public reporting of tips, higher attendance at community meetings, and improved sentiment in local surveys. These metrics help departments understand if their efforts are genuinely building trust and addressing local needs. There is also the question of scalability; while the model shows promise, its effectiveness can depend heavily on department leadership commitment, available training, and the specific demographics and culture of the area served.

However, there are also important considerations and potential drawbacks to acknowledge. Success requires significant investment in training, time, and consistent leadership to ensure the approach is implemented authentically and not just as a public relations gesture. There is a risk that if not executed well, community meetings can become performative, failing to address deeper systemic issues or community grievances. Furthermore, this model may face challenges in diverse communities with complex historical tensions or varying levels of trust in institutional authority. Realistic expectations are essential; building genuine trust is a slow process that cannot be rushed or forced.
